north-south. In the general case, the axial trace and fold axis are plotted as points on
the stereogram and the great circle that passes through both points is the axial surface.
If the axial trace and the hinge line coincide, as is the case for hinges 1 and 2 in Fig. 5.10,
this procedure is not applicable. It is then necessary to have additional information,
either the trace of the axial surface on another horizon or the relative bed thickness
change across the axial surface.
The intersection of two axial surfaces (Fig. 5.19) is an important line for defining
the complete dip-domain geometry, and is here designated as the

The orientation of the
α
line is found by first finding the axial surfaces, and then
their line of intersection. The stereogram solution is to draw the great circles for both
axial surfaces and locate the point where they cross (Fig. 5.20), which is the orienta-
tion of the line of intersection. The analytical solution for the
α
line is that for the
line of intersection between two planes (Eqs. 5.5-5.8), in which the two planes are
axial surfaces.

5.4.3
Location in 3-D
For a 3-D interpretation the axial surfaces and the
lines must be located in space as
well as in orientation. If hinge lines are known from more than one horizon they can
be combined to create a map (Fig. 5.21). The axial surface is the structure contour
map of equal elevations on the hinge lines.
